- The distance between Mcgill, Nv, Usa and Pilar Obs, Argentina is approximately 9,487 km or 5,896 mi.
- To reach Mcgill, Nv in this distance one would set out from Pilar Obs bearing 323°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Mcgill, Nv bearing 318.5° or NW .
- Mcgill, Nv has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k) whereas Pilar Obs has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a).
- Mcgill, Nv is in or near the boreal dry scrub biome whereas Pilar Obs is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ome.
- The mean annual temperature is 9.8 °C (17.6°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 10.7 °C (19.3°F) more in Mcgill, Nv.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 567.7 mm (22.4 in) less which is equivalent to 567.7 l/m² (13.93 US gal/ft²) or 5,677,000 l/ha (606,909 US gal/ac) less. About 2/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 7° lower in Mcgill, Nv than in Pilar Obs.
